Mass murderer and serial killer Donald Henry "Pee Wee" Gaskins prowled the coastal highways of South Carolina commiting acts of torture and murder unmatched in the annals of American crime.
Gaskins autobiography, written with author Wilton Earle, has sold more than 100,000 copies in hardcover and has been a best-seller in seven foreign countries including Japan.
This DVD contains all the research materials gathered by Earle in his collaboration with Gaskins.
